Garba Tula weather in March
In March, Garba Tula sees average daytime highs of 34°C and overnight lows near 24°C, with 42 mm of rain across 6.6 wet days and about 12 hours of daylight. It is the 1st-warmest and 4th-wettest month of the year here.
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 34°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 52% of the time in March, and the air most often feels muggy.
Daylight stretches from about 12 hours at the start of March to 12 hours by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, March is Garba Tula's 6th-clearest and 8th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Garba Tula's year-round climate.

Temperature in March
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 34°C through the month.
A typical March day in Garba Tula reaches about 34°C in the afternoon and slips back to 24°C overnight — a 10°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 32°C and 36°C. Set against its neighbours, March runs on par with February and on par with April.

Garba Tula weather by month
How March compares with the rest of the year at a glance. March is the 1st-warmest and 4th-wettest month here — the current month is highlighted below.
| Month | High / Low (°C) | Rainfall (mm) | Wet days | Daylight (hours) | Travel score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 32° / 22° | 30 | 3.8 | 12 | 4.7 |
| Feb | 33° / 23° | 10 | 1.7 | 12 | 4.0 |
| Mar | 34° / 24° | 42 | 6.6 | 12 | 3.4 |
| Apr | 33° / 24° | 75 | 12.3 | 12 | 3.3 |
| May | 33° / 24° | 13 | 3.3 | 12 | 4.0 |
| Jun | 32° / 23° | 1 | 0.1 | 12 | 4.7 |
| Jul | 31° / 22° | 0 | 0.1 | 12 | 5.2 |
| Aug | 32° / 22° | 0 | 0.1 | 12 | 5.1 |
| Sep | 33° / 22° | 1 | 0.3 | 12 | 4.4 |
| Oct | 33° / 23° | 37 | 5.8 | 12 | 3.7 |
| Nov | 31° / 23° | 119 | 18.1 | 12 | 3.7 |
| Dec | 31° / 22° | 72 | 11.4 | 12 | 4.5 |

Where is Garba Tula?
Garba Tula sits at 0.5°N, 38.5°E, 512 m above sea level, in Kenya. The nearest listed city is Maua, 72 km away.
Topography around Garba Tula
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Garba Tula.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Garba Tula has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 46 m around an average of 516 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 191 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,289 m.
The land around Garba Tula is covered by shrubs (82%) within 3 km, shrubs (94%) within 16 km, and shrubs (60%) and grassland (34%) within 80 km.
